Chicken Tikka Masala

60 min 598 kcal per serving Medium

Ingredients

4 Servings
  • chicken breast500 g
  • plain yogurt1 cup
  • lemon juice2 tbsp
  • ground cumin2 tsp
  • ground coriander2 tsp
  • ground turmeric1 tsp
  • ground paprika1 tsp
  • garam masala1 tsp
  • ground cayenne pepper1 tsp
  • vegetable oil1 tbsp
  • large onion1 piece
  • garlic3 cloves
  • fresh ginger1 tbsp
  • diced tomatoes400 g
  • heavy cream1 cup
  • fresh cilantro1/2 cup

Instructions

  1. 1

    In a large bowl, combine the plain yogurt, lemon juice, ground cumin, ground coriander, ground turmeric, ground paprika, garam masala, and ground cayenne pepper. Mix well.

  2. 2

    Add the chicken breast pieces to the marinade, ensuring they are well coated.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, or overnight for best results.

  3. 3

    Heat the v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the finely chopped onion and cook until golden brown, about 5-7 minutes.

  4. 4

    Add the minced garlic and grated fresh ginger to the skillet. Cook for another 1-2 minutes until fragrant.

  5. 5

    Add the marinated chicken pieces to the skillet. Cook until the chicken is no longer pink, about 5-7 minutes.

  6. 6

    Stir in the diced tomatoes and bring the mixture to a simmer. Cook for 10-15 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ld together.

  7. 7

    Reduce the heat to low and stir in the heavy cream. Simmer for an additional 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.

  8. 8

    Garnish with chopped fresh cilantro before serving. Enjoy your Chicken Tikka Masala with rice or naan bread.
